news 2026/1/10 12:46:25

AI肖像动画技术:让静态照片瞬间“活“起来的魔法

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
AI肖像动画技术:让静态照片瞬间“活“起来的魔法

AI肖像动画技术:让静态照片瞬间"活"起来的魔法

【免费下载链接】LivePortraitBring portraits to life!项目地址: https://gitcode.com/GitHub_Trending/li/LivePortrait

想象一下,你珍藏多年的老照片突然动了起来,照片中的人物开始微笑、眨眼,甚至跟你说话。这不再是科幻电影中的场景,而是AI肖像动画技术带来的真实体验。通过先进的人工智能算法,现在任何人都能轻松将静态肖像转化为生动的动态影像。

技术原理揭秘:AI如何让照片动起来

AI肖像动画技术的核心在于三个关键环节:特征提取、运动分析和图像生成。系统首先通过appearance_feature_extractor模块精准捕捉人物面部的独特特征,然后利用motion_extractor解析驱动视频中的动作模式,最后通过spade_generator实现自然流畅的动态效果。

整个过程就像一位数字艺术家在精心创作:先观察原图的细节特征,再学习动作的精髓,最后将两者完美结合,创造出既保留原貌又充满活力的动态影像。

实战操作指南:从零开始制作动画肖像

环境准备与安装

首先需要准备合适的运行环境。建议使用支持CUDA的NVIDIA显卡,显存4GB以上,这样可以获得最佳的处理效果。安装步骤非常简单:

  1. 获取项目代码:
git clone https://gitcode.com/GitHub_Trending/li/LivePortrait cd LivePortrait
  1. 安装必要的依赖包:
pip install -r requirements.txt
  1. 启动应用界面:
  • 人像模式:python app.py
  • 动物模式:python app_animals.py

素材选择技巧

选择合适的源图像和驱动文件至关重要:

源图像要求

  • 清晰的正面肖像照片
  • 面部无遮挡,光线充足
  • 推荐分辨率512×512像素

驱动文件类型

  • MP4格式视频文件
  • PKL动作模板文件

多场景应用方案

人像动画专业制作

LivePortrait的人像模式专门针对人物肖像优化,支持精细的头部姿态调整和表情变化。系统内置的68点面部关键点检测技术确保动画效果的自然度和准确性。

宠物动画精准优化

动物模式经过专门的技术调优,能够准确识别猫、狗等常见宠物的面部特征。通过animal_landmark_runner模块,生成符合生物特征的动态效果,让可爱的宠物照片也变得生动有趣。

性能优化与问题解决

硬件配置建议

为了获得最佳体验,推荐以下配置:

  • GPU环境:NVIDIA显卡,显存4GB以上
  • CPU环境:主流处理器,内存8GB以上

参数调节技巧

运动强度参数(motion_multiplier)是控制动画效果的关键:

  • 推荐值范围:1.0-1.5
  • 较低值:产生更自然的轻微动作
  • 较高值:制造更夸张的戏剧效果

常见问题处理

面部对齐问题:启用自动裁剪功能,确保面部在图像中居中显示。

运动不自然:适当降低运动强度参数,检查驱动视频的质量和清晰度。

创意应用场景

这项技术为各种场景带来了全新的可能性:

社交媒体内容:为个人资料照片添加动态效果,在朋友圈中脱颖而出。

数字纪念品:让老照片中的亲人"活"过来,创造感人的家庭回忆。

在线教育:让历史人物肖像动起来,让教学内容更加生动有趣。

技术发展趋势

AI肖像动画技术正在快速发展,未来将呈现以下趋势:

实时处理能力:朝着实时视频驱动的方向发展,实现更流畅的交互体验。

姿态编辑功能:增加更多精细的姿态控制选项,满足专业创作需求。

跨平台兼容:优化在不同设备和系统上的运行表现。

实用操作建议

图像质量优化

为了获得最佳效果,建议:

  • 选择高分辨率的原始图像
  • 确保面部清晰可见,没有阴影遮挡
  • 使用光线均匀的拍摄环境

处理效率提升

在优化配置下,系统处理速度可达到:

  • 图像驱动:约0.1秒/帧
  • 视频驱动:约0.2秒/帧

结语:开启动态影像创作新时代

AI肖像动画技术不仅降低了动态影像创作的门槛,更为普通用户提供了专业级的创作工具。无论你是想要为社交媒体内容增添亮点,还是想要制作独特的数字纪念品,这项技术都能满足你的需求。

现在就开始尝试,用AI技术让你的照片真正"活"起来,开启全新的数字创作体验!

【免费下载链接】LivePortraitBring portraits to life!项目地址: https://gitcode.com/GitHub_Trending/li/LivePortrait

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/1/3 9:23:21

ROCm Windows环境PyTorch深度学习部署技术解析

ROCm Windows环境PyTorch深度学习部署技术解析 【免费下载链接】ROCm AMD ROCm™ Software - GitHub Home 项目地址: https://gitcode.com/GitHub_Trending/ro/ROCm 随着AMD显卡在消费级市场的普及,越来越多的开发者希望在Windows系统上利用AMD硬件进行深度学…

作者头像 李华
网站建设 2026/1/8 0:46:26

深度集成Windows X Lite:在Dockur/Windows项目中实现极致轻量化部署

Windows X Lite作为Windows系统的深度优化版本,通过移除非必要组件和服务实现了显著的资源精简,系统安装后仅占用1-3GB磁盘空间。这种轻量化特性使其成为Dockur/Windows项目中的理想集成对象,能够在保持完整Windows功能的同时大幅降低资源消耗…

作者头像 李华
网站建设 2026/1/10 10:44:27

终极数据血缘可视化工具:jsplumb-dataLineage-vue 完全指南

终极数据血缘可视化工具:jsplumb-dataLineage-vue 完全指南 【免费下载链接】jsplumb-dataLineage-vue https://github.com/mizuhokaga/jsplumb-dataLineage 数据血缘前端 jsplumb-dataLineage的Vue版本(Vue2、Vue3均实现) 项目地址: https…

作者头像 李华
网站建设 2025/12/19 18:02:16

【Open-AutoGLM安全加固手册】:3类高危场景的防御策略与实操步骤

第一章:Open-AutoGLM支付操作安全防护概述 在Open-AutoGLM系统中,支付操作作为核心业务流程之一,其安全性直接关系到用户资产与平台信誉。为保障交易过程的完整性、机密性与不可抵赖性,系统采用多层安全机制进行综合防护。 数据传…

作者头像 李华
网站建设 2025/12/19 18:02:09

QT样式表模板库:快速美化Qt应用界面的终极解决方案

QT样式表模板库:快速美化Qt应用界面的终极解决方案 【免费下载链接】QSS QT Style Sheets templates 项目地址: https://gitcode.com/gh_mirrors/qs/QSS 🚀 让您的Qt应用在30秒内拥有专业级UI界面! QT样式表模板库(QSS&…

作者头像 李华
网站建设 2026/1/1 3:02:43

xterm.js WebGL渲染器:为什么它能将终端性能提升400%?

xterm.js WebGL渲染器:为什么它能将终端性能提升400%? 【免费下载链接】xterm.js 项目地址: https://gitcode.com/gh_mirrors/xte/xterm.js 在当今Web应用日益复杂的背景下,终端性能优化已成为开发者必须面对的挑战。xterm.js作为业界…

作者头像 李华